Croque Madame
A Croque Monsieur topped with a perfectly fried sunny-side-up egg.

Instructions
- 1
Assemble and bake the base: Build the sandwich with Dijon, ham, and half the Gruyère between the toasted sourdough slices. Top with the béchamel sauce and the remaining Gruyère.
- 2
Broil the sandwich on a baking sheet for 3-5 minutes until the topping is bubbly and golden brown.
- 3
While the sandwich is under the broiler, heat a small non-stick skillet over medium-low heat. Melt the butter until it starts to foam gently.
- 4
Crack the egg into the skillet and cook slowly for 3-4 minutes. You want the whites completely set and opaque, but the yolk must remain runny. Season lightly with salt and pepper.
- 5
Carefully remove the hot, bubbling Croque Monsieur from the oven and transfer it to a warm plate.
- 6
Using a delicate spatula, gently slide the sunny-side-up egg directly onto the top of the melted cheese sauce. Serve immediately, allowing the yolk to act as a rich sauce when broken.
